Tonight: Project Art Fundraiser
Massive art show featuring local talents aims to raise funds for holistic cancer treatments

Toronto artist Sam Shuter‘s work

Project Art launches tonight at the Burroughes, and it looks like it’s going to be a rager.

The brainchild of co-founders Emma Tushinski, Ben Cowley, Matt Cohen, and Zac Cooper, the event aims to raise money for hollisitic cancer treatments at the Odette Cancer Centre. The team had a very personal motivation since Tushinski was diagnosed with a form of Leukemia nearly three years ago. In addition to a partnership with the Sunnybrook Foundation, the event’s other main goal is to showcase a number of local visual, performance, and musical artists. 

Aside from my bias of writing this article, the event is looking pretty stellar. When you put together the venue (The Burroughs – The Standard’s home sweet home), the incredibly promising list of featured artists, and the already exciting guestlist, the event is sure to be one for the books. Plus, the cause certainly doesn’t hurt either.
